[分享]iOS开发-修改/自定义导航栏标题navigationItem

news/2024/7/4 9:13:18

效果图:
图片描述

代码示例:

    //在viewDidLoad中:   
    NSString * childNumber = [NSString stringWithFormat:@"%@", responseObject[@"rtn"][@"body"][@"serviceCount"]];
    NSString * item = [NSString stringWithFormat:@"目前正在管理服务%@名儿童", childNumber];
    NSMutableAttributedString * attString = [[NSMutableAttributedString alloc] initWithString:item];
    [attString addAttributes:@{NSForegroundColorAttributeName:kColorYellow} range:[item rangeOfString:childNumber]];
    itemLabel = [[UILabel alloc] initWithFrame:CGRectMake(5, 5, 200, 20)];
    itemLabel.textColor = [UIColor whiteColor];
    itemLabel.attributedText = attString;
    self.navigationItem.titleView = itemLabel;

http://www.niftyadmin.cn/n/2571500.html

相关文章

pyqt5 qmessagebox 不阻碍_使用 Pyqt5 制作猜数游戏 GUI

这一节,我们介绍如何使用 Pyqt5 实现猜数游戏界面。游戏效果图:一、使用 Qt Designer首先,选择 Pycharm ->File->Settings-> Tools->External Tools,点击 ,添加新项目。name 可以设为 qt5,Program 那项填…

C语言输入字母变量怎么声明,C语言教学(三)变量的类型与定义

原标题:C语言教学(三)变量的类型与定义上一篇讲介绍了一些C语言常见的符号,这一篇给大家介绍几个C语言常用的变量类型。这里简单的介绍前面3个常用的类型,太复杂的就不讲那么多,只要记得定义整数变量基本用int就够了,i…

c语言一维数组字符串数组初始化,一维数组的定义、初始化和引用

一维数组的定义、初始化和引用 一维数组的定义、初始化和引用 1.一维数组的定义方式为:类型说明符 数组名[常量表达式](1)数组名的命名方法与变量名相同,遵循标识符命名规则;(2)数组是用方括号括起来的常量表达式,不能用圆括号;(3…

Fastjson-fastjson中$ref对象重复引用问题

当你有城市数据,你需要按国内、国际、热门城市分成数组的形式给出并输出为json格式。 第一个问题,你的数据格式,需要按字母类别划分,比如: "int": {"C": [{"acityId": "1001"…

ipython的安装

linux下python的查看[rootcentOS64A67 ~]# uname -r //查看内核版本2.6.32-573.el6.x86_64 //我的CentOs6.7呵呵[rootcentOS64A67 ~]# rpm -q python //查看安装的python的rpm包python-2.6.6-64.el6.x8…

FastStone Capture(FSCapture)

FastStone Capture(FSCapture) 注册码 企业版序列号: name:bluman serial/序列号/注册码:VPISCJULXUFGDDXYAUYF FastStone Capture 注册码 序列号: name/用户名:TEAM JiOO key/注册码:CPCWXRVCZW30HMKE8KQQ…

.NET Core 跨平台发布(dotnet publish)

.NET Core 跨平台发布(dotnet publish) ,无需安装.NET Core SDK,就可以运行。 前面讲解了.NET Core 的VSCode 开发。现在来讲讲发布(dotnet publish)。 .NET Core and ASP.NET Core 1.0 RC2 runtime and libraries 在五月中旬发布。 .NET Core and ASP.N…

swift 报错 Call can throw, but it is not marked with 'try' and the error is not handled

在开发中使用正则表达式时报了这样的问题:Call can throw, but it is not marked with try and the error is not handled,即: let regex:NSRegularExpression NSRegularExpression(pattern: "^1[3|4|5|7|8][0-9]{9}$", options: …